Sushi restaurant to open in St Georges
A sushi restaurant is one of two new businesses opening in the Town of St. Georges.
Tamasuns Japanese House will open in the former Crissons store on the corner on York Street.
The owner is Tammy Jean Warner, who is currently looking to hire staff for the restaurant, described as offering sushi, sashimi, tamaki, tempura, and fusion wok dishes.
The space has been gutted and completely refitted.
A new convenience is expected to open soon in the vacant space opposite Burrows Lightbourn liquor store on York Street. Its currently being renovated.
The Old Town has seen a burst of new businesses opening in the last 12 months, including Chris Dawson Fine Art Studio and the Endemic Arts Collective, whose tattoo studio is expected to open in the spring.
